Tender Title: Syringe Infusion Pump
Tender Reference Number: GEM/2025/B/6162816
The Syringe Infusion Pump tender is issued by the Health and Family Welfare Department Mizoram. This tender aims to procure ten (10) Syringe Infusion Pumps essential for enhancing healthcare delivery and improving patient care standards in medical facilities.
Scope of Work and Objectives
The primary objective of this tender is to acquire Syringe Infusion Pumps that meet the prevailing healthcare standards. The effective integration of these pumps into medical practices will assist healthcare professionals in administering precise dosages of medication and fluids to patients, thereby increasing the efficiency and safety of treatments.
